How To Make Spelt & Wild Mushroom Risotto

Preparation: 10 minutes
Cooking: 30 minutes
Total: 40 minutes

Serves:

Ingredients

  • 1 cup spelt
  • 4 cups vegetable broth
  • 1 tbsp olive oil
  • 1 onion, diced
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 8 oz wild mushrooms, sliced
  • 1/2 cup white wine
  • 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• Salt and pepper, to taste
  • Fresh parsley, for garnish

Instructions

  1. In a large saucepan, bring the vegetable broth to a simmer. Keep warm.

  2. In a separate large saucepan, heat the olive oil over medium heat. Add the onion and garlic and cook until softened, about 3 minutes.

  3. Add the spelt to the saucepan and cook for 1 minute, stirring constantly.

  4. Add the sliced mushrooms to the saucepan and cook for an additional 2 minutes.

  5. Pour in the white wine and cook until it has evaporated.

  6. Begin adding the warm vegetable broth, 1 cup at a time, stirring frequently and allowing the liquid to absorb before adding more.

  7. Continue adding the broth and stirring until the spelt is tender and creamy, about 20-25 minutes.

  8. Stir in the Parmesan cheese until melted and season with salt and pepper to taste.

  9. Serve the risotto hot, garnished with fresh parsley.

Nutrition

  • Calories : 285kcal
  • Total Fat : 8g
  • Saturated Fat : 2g
  • Cholesterol : 7mg
  • Sodium : 1483mg
  • Total Carbohydrates : 38g
  • Dietary Fiber : 8g
  • Sugar : 3g
  • Protein : 14g
